C语言I博客作业09

这个作业属于哪个课程 C语言程序设计I
这个作业的要求在哪里 https://edu.cnblogs.com/campus/zswxy/CST2019-2/homework/9934
我在这个课程的目标 学会利用学到的知识编程一些有趣且有用的程序
这个作业在那个具体方面帮助我实现目标 学会利用多种语句进行组合
参考文献 C primer Plus ,C语言程序设计(第3版),C语言实验指导,百度

1.PTA实验作业

1.1换硬币

C语言I博客作业09_第1张图片


1.1.1数据处理
数据处理:定义整形c,count=0,用for语句分别计算各个硬币的数量。
数据表达:fen5:int x=(c-2-1)/5;x>=1;x--) fen2:int y=(c-1-5)/2;y>=1;y--) fen1: z=c-5x-2y
伪代码
C语言I博客作业09_第2张图片


1.1.2实验代码截图
C语言I博客作业09_第3张图片


1.1.3造测试数据
C语言I博客作业09_第4张图片


1.1.4PTA提交列表及其说明

1.编译错误:在打后面注释时少打了/,导致编译出现了错误。
2.答案正确:检查并改正后得到的结果就是正确了。

1.2跟奥巴马一起画方块

C语言I博客作业09_第5张图片


1.2.1数据处理
数据处理:定义三个整形n i j以及字符a,分奇偶两个情况用for语句处理。
数据表达:n为偶数时,i<=n/2;n为奇数时,i<=(n+1)/2。


伪代码
C语言I博客作业09_第6张图片

1.2.2实验代码截图
C语言I博客作业09_第7张图片


1.2.3造测试数据
C语言I博客作业09_第8张图片C语言I博客作业09_第9张图片


1.2.4PTA提交列表及其说明

1.编译错误:i++少打了一个+
2.部分正确:i=1为i=0
3.答案正确:修改后提交即答案正确

2.代码互评

同学代码截图(硬币)
C语言I博客作业09_第10张图片

自己代码截图

C语言I博客作业09_第11张图片

1.这位同学的代码第一眼看过去有点懵,因为定义的名称有点不方便阅读,其次表达式需要仔细阅读才能看懂,相比而言我的较为简单易懂
2.我在代码后加了自己的注释,能帮助理解,且排版比较舒适。

3.学习总结

3.1学习进度条

C语言I博客作业09_第12张图片


3.2累计代码行和博客字数

C语言I博客作业09_第13张图片


3.3学习内容总结和感悟

3.3.1学习内容总结

C语言I博客作业09_第14张图片


3.3.2学习体会

答:本周的学习状态较之前有所好转,不过自己对于时间的管理还不够严格,偶尔会萌生偷懒的想法,想好好的睡一觉,不过目前的学习计划有点赶,时间的合理分配尤其重要,专业知识的重视必不可少,心态有时会有点不好,也是因为由于时间紧张的缘故,不过目前在自我调节,希望自己能在期末取得一个好成绩!

你可能感兴趣的:(C语言I博客作业09)